Summary:

The House Supervisor RN provides leadership and oversight of nursing operations during shifts to ensure quality care, patient safety, and smooth hospital functioning. This role encompasses staff supervision, patient flow management, crisis intervention, and collaboration with multidisciplinary teams to optimize patient care and hospital operations.

Essential Work Functions:
  • Supervise and support nursing staff during shifts, ensuring efficient patient care and adherence to hospital policies
  • Coordinate and monitor patient admissions, transfers, and discharges to maintain optimal patient flow
  • Ensure compliance with hospital policies, procedures, and regulatory standards, addressing deviations promptly
  • Adjust staffing levels in response to patient acuity and census, ensuring appropriate coverage for all units
  • Respond to emergencies and provide leadership during critical situations, ensuring patient and staff safety
  • Collaborate with department leaders, administrators, and multidisciplinary teams to address hospital-wide operational needs
  • Serve as a resource for staff, patients, and families, addressing concerns and resolving conflicts professionally
  • Participate in quality assurance initiatives to enhance patient outcomes and operational efficiency
  • Utilize electronic health records and incident reporting systems to document and communicate operational activities
  • Lead emergency preparedness efforts, ensuring readiness to respond to disasters or large‑scale events
  • Perform other duties as assigned within the scope of practice
